Just a few clicks away is a living digital organism.

Born on the 12th May 2021, this creature feeds on the participation of its visitors. Without input from external sources, it will remain in the same form: an embryo not yet fully developed, ready to grow and feed on the information of others.

This artificial organism cannot become fully formed without humans to achieve its goals. It employs computational processes to convert human inputted data into its biological make-up.

Sarah Selby: Artist Bio

Sarah Selby is an interdisciplinary artist exploring digital culture through creative applications of emerging and pervasive technology. Her work blurs the boundaries between the digital and physical, manifesting intangible systems and interactions to explore how they overlap, contradict and impact one another. 

Sarah was the winner of arebyte Gallery’s ‘Hotel Generation’ programme resulting in the production of ‘Raised by Google’, featured in FAD magazine and Timeout. She was shortlisted for The Ashurst Emerging Artist Prize for her interactive artwork ‘If you leave it up to the audience, they can kill you’ and was selected to participate in Roche Continents, an international residency exploring sources of inspiration at the intersection of science and art. Sarah is a member of ‘The Immersive Kind’, a multidisciplinary collective exploring a tomorrow that is accessible, inclusive and sustainable through pioneering creative technology.
